Alonso wins the Internet with deckchair stunt

In a season of toils and woes for McLaren-Honda, Fernando Alonso showed he had not lost his sense of humour during qualifying for the 2015 Brazilian Grand Prix, which took place on this date one year ago. After suffering yet another failure, the Spaniard simply decided to enjoy the rest of the session from a deckchair he had found trackside. The image went viral under the #PlacesAlonsoWouldRatherBe hashtag, which made a glorious return during this year’s edition when Alonso turned FOM cameraman in FP2
